Toys For Bob, the developers behind the new Spyro the Dragon game, revealed during the Xbox Game Showcase that the upcoming title will feature 'true dragon flight' for the first time. This mechanic presents a unique challenge, as the developers noted there are few comparable games that offer the same level of verticality and freedom of movement. The studio emphasized that Spyro's flight will feel distinct from other flying mechanics in games, such as those found in flight simulators or superhero titles like Iron Man. The new game, Spyro: A Realm Beyond, promises a more open and dynamic world, with level design that incorporates true flight as a core gameplay element. Voice actor Tom Kenny, known for his role as SpongeBob SquarePants, will return to voice Spyro. The game is set to release in Spring 2027 on multiple platforms.
